Add 90/63 and 10/90

1st number: 1 27/63, 2nd number: 10/90

90/63 + 10/90 is 97/63.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 63 and 90 is 630

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 630
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 63 × 10 = 630,
    90/63 = 90 × 10/63 × 10 = 900/630
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 90 × 7 = 630,
    10/90 = 10 × 7/90 × 7 = 70/630
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    900/630 + 70/630 = 900 + 70/630 = 970/630
  5. 970/630 simplified gives 97/63
  6. So, 90/63 + 10/90 = 97/63
